#3c022e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c022e is composed of 23.5% red, 0.8%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.7% magenta, 23.3% yellow and 76.5% black. It has a hue angle of 314.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 12.2%. #3c022e color hex could be obtained by blending #78045c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#3c022e color description : Very dark magenta.
#3c022e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3c022e has RGB values of R:60, G:2,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.23,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 3932718.
